Support S3 read-only IAM user roles

I want to setup research environments to have read-only access to the S3 account containing our databases. However, it looks like quantrocket db s3config checks for create bucket permissions to validate the configuration, which shouldn't be necessary for QR installations that will only be using s3pull.

I agree, read-only should be supported here.

Read-only users are supported in version 2.3.0.